Will you spend $400 for an audio recorder? I don’t know but why I think that is too pricey. May be Sony knows why its new PCM-D10 audio recorder worth that price. So lets take a look at its specs, capable of recording 96kHz/24-bit stereo audio, the PCM-D10 has 4GB of built in memory and a MicroSD/Memory Stick Micro slot in case you need larger storage. Expected to come in October, this flash-based recorder also features a built-in mic and speaker, digital limiter, and allows you to record in MP3 format.
